What is Third Party Logistics and What are the Advantages?

third party logistics

Third Party Logistics (3PL) is businesses that provide one or more varieties of amenities associated with logistics. These services include public and contract warehousing, transportation and distribution management, and freight merging. Third Party Logistics companies stock your product within a warehouse and then ship it to the customer on your behalf. If you’re an e-commerce business, you will want to look for a 3PL that is an expert in inventory management, fulfillment, and returns.

Third Party Logistics play a vital role in the supply chain. From raw materials processed and made by a manufacturer, to packaging and transportation by air, land, or sea, to being stored in a warehouse to be shipped to a user, there are many moving parts. That entire process runs smoothly because of logistics companies working behind the scenes communicating, planning, and coordination. Companies that choose to work with a logistics business will not need to be bothered with the challenges that often arise like customs regulations and the right transportation methods.

Advantages:

• Working with a Professional – The primary focus of a 3PL is to optimize how a company handles their shipments. They are knowledgeable about everything that involves distribution management, warehousing, and shipping.

• Behind-The-Scenes – One of the obstacles of cultivating worldwide is dealing with global fulfillment. Outsourcing the responsibility of documentation, customs, duties, and other issues that arise when dealing with overseas sales will make it easier overall to sell within your country, rush time to delivery and lower shipping prices.

• Cost Efficiency – Because 3PLs specialize in logistics, they have specific expertise compared to their clients. Logistics firms can strategize and lessen a company’s overall delivery and inventory costs, and improve management. 3PLs specialize in meeting the technical requirements to keep IT systems updated more budget and time economically.
